About Bay Cities Produce Inc
Bay Cities Produce Company was founded in 1947 by Albert Del Masso and was managed by him and his son Steve until Al's passing in 2014. Steve has been involved since he was 7 years old, accompanying his father on his daily produce route. What Is the Cost of Living Near Oakland?

Understanding the cost of living near Oakland is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Bay Cities Produce Inc.
Oakland's Cost of Living Index is approximately 174.4 (74.4% more expensive than US average; 24.7% more than CA average). Major Bay Area city, extremely high housing costs, significant gentrification, high overall expenses. BART hub.
